Special Features & Unique Opportunities

Archbold Internal Medicine Residency Program has partnered with the Medical College of Georgia to increase resources for faculty and residents. This partnership also supports residents interested in pursuing fellowship. A Primary Care Track is available within the program for residents interested in practicing in the outpatient or blended inpatient/outpatient setting. A 4th year Chief position is also available to aid residents pursuing fellowship after residency.
